Hi, please make sure to use Blender 2.83 LTS. We're working on 2.9 support and I guess that it will be finished for the next SDK version, but it is not yet supported. That's where the second error message
AttributeError: 'RigidBodyWorld' object has no attribute 'steps_per_second'
comes from.Regarding the first error: could you please open an issue with a minimal example file? The material that's causing this bug is probably called
Cloud.003
.There are unsupported nodes, but if you use them, there should be a warning message printed to the console to inform you. Here you can find a list of supported material nodes.
